BAKED SWORDFISH WITH OLIVE RELISH

Categories     Fish     Olive     Bake     Bell Pepper     Healthy     Bon Appétit

Yield Serves 4

Number Of Ingredients 10



Baked Swordfish with Olive Relish image

Steps:

  • Combine all olives, roasted peppers, parsley, minced anchovies, capers, vinegar and garlic in small bowl. Stir in 1 tablespoon olive oil. Season with salt and pepper. Let stand 1 hour. (Can be made 1 day ahead. Cover and chill. Serve at room temperature. )
  • Preheat oven to 400°F. Place swordfish steaks on large baking sheet. Brush swordfish on both sides with remaining 2 tablespoons olive oil. Season with salt and pepper. Bake just until fish is cooked through, about 10 minutes. Transfer to platter. Spoon olive relish over swordfish and serve.

1/3 cup chopped pitted green brine-cured olives (such as Greek or Italian)
1/3 cup chopped pitted black brine-cured olives (such as Kalamata)
1/4 cup chopped roasted red peppers from jar
1 tablespoon minced fresh parsley
2 anchovy fillets, minced
2 teaspoons drained capers
1 teaspoon red wine vinegar
1 large garlic clove, minced
3 tablespoons olive oil
4 6-ounce swordfish steaks (about 3/4 inch thick)

SWORDFISH WITH OLIVE, PINENUT, AND PARSLEY RELISH

Provided by Bon Appétit Test Kitchen

Categories     Fish     Garlic     Olive     Low Cal     Dinner     Pine Nut     Parsley     Swordfish     Bon Appétit     Pescatarian     Paleo     Dairy Free     Wheat/Gluten-Free     Peanut Free     Soy Free     Kosher

Yield Makes 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 9



Swordfish with Olive, Pinenut, and Parsley Relish image

Steps:

  • Sprinkle fish with 1/2 teaspoon red pepper, salt, and pepper. Heat 1 tablespoon oil in large nonstick skillet over medium-high heat. Add fish; cook until opaque in center, 4 to 5 minutes per side. Transfer to platter; cover. Add 1 tablespoon oil and shallots to skillet; sauté over medium heat until golden, 3 to 4 minutes. Add 1/8 teaspoon red pepper, garlic, and olives; sauté 1 minute. Add pine nuts, parsley, and wine; boil until most of liquid is gone, 30 seconds. Season with salt and pepper. Spoon over fish.

4 5- to 6-ounce swordfish steaks
1/2 teaspoon plus 1/8 teaspoon dried crushed red pepper
2 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il, divided
1 1/4 cups thinly sliced shallots
2 large garlic cloves, minced
1/2 cup pitted brine-cured green olives, quartered lengthwise
3 tablespoons pine nuts, toasted
1/2 cup chopped fresh Italian parsley
1/3 cup dry white wine
